Overview

Crime Control and Women reveals the current limitations of criminal justice policies that are oblivious to the impact they exert on citizens who vary by gender, race and/or social class. Feminist in perspective, the contributors to this volume share a common vision of hope that social change will result from social control and punishment that is just and human, with commitments to prevention, education, and treatment.

Table of Contents

Introduction - Susan L Miller
Three Strikes and You're Out! What Will Women Pay for the Pitch? - Mona Danner
Civil Forfeiture of Property - James Massey, Susan L Miller and Anna Wilhelmi
The Victimization of Women as Innocent Owners and Third Parties
A Critical Look at the Idea of Boot Camp as a Correctional Reform - Merry Morash and Lila Rucker
Warnings to Women - Elizabeth A Stanko
Police Advice and Women's Safety in Britain
Gender, Class and Race in Three High Profile Crimes - Lynn Chancer
The Cases of New Bedford, Central Park and Bensonhurst
The Tangled Web of Feminism and Community Policing - Susan L Miller
Investigating the Impact of the ‘War on Drugs' on the Incarceration of Black Females - Stephanie Bush-Baskette
Parenting through Prison Walls - Zoann K Snyder-Joy and Teresa A Carlo
Incarcerated Mothers and Children's Visitation Programs
Masculinities, Violence and Communitarian Control - John Braithwaite and Kathleen Daly
Connecting the Dots - Claire M Renzetti
Women, Public Policy and Social Control
